Output 050cc177ca3f806e76bc4aee1cb915e2f24884307655bf9082f6a12923739ee0:58

value
1005000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fee7b443f88a800b564ec784f4c625b8b42eabe OP_EQUAL
address
3BtrcpfyFpSwmwdcMv1mDa14qKnVrR6JUF
transaction
050cc177ca3f806e76bc4aee1cb915e2f24884307655bf9082f6a12923739ee0
confirmations
248468
spent
true